CHEESE STRAWS



Cheese Straws image

Provided by Ina Garten

Time 30m

Yield 22 to 24 straws

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 sheets (1 box) frozen puff pastry (preferably Pepperidge Farm), defrosted overnight in the refrigerator
1 extra-large egg
1/2 cup freshly grated parmesan cheese
1 cup finely grated gruyere cheese
1 teaspoon minced fresh thyme leaves
1 teaspoon kosher salt
Fre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
  • Roll out each sheet of puff pastry on a lightly floured board until it's 10 by 12 inches. Beat the egg with 1 tablespoon of water and brush the surface of the pastry. Sprinkle each sheet evenly with 1/4 cup of the parmesan, 1/2 cup of the gruyere, 1/2 teaspoon of the thyme, 1/2 teaspoon of the salt, and some pepper. With the rolling pin, lightly press the flavorings into the puff pastry. Cut each sheet crosswise with a floured knife or pizza wheel into 11 or 12 strips. Twist each strip and lay on baking sheets lined with parchment paper.
  • Bake for 10 to 15 minutes, until lightly browned and puffed. Turn each straw and bake for another 2 minutes. Don't overbake or the cheese will burn. Cool and serve at room temperature.

PUFF-PASTRY CHEESE STRAWS



Puff-Pastry Cheese Straws image

Whenever possible, use all-butter puff pastry, such as Trader Joe's or Dufour, for the best flavor and texture. For even thawing, let it sit in the refrigerator overnight, rather than on the counter, which can cause the pastry to become sticky and difficult to work with. This recipe is adapted from Martha Stewart's Appetizers.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Appetizers     Finger Food Recipes

Time 1h35m

Yield Makes about 30

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 cup finely grated Parmigiano-Reggiano (about 4 ounces)
1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
2 sheets frozen puff pastry, preferably all-butter, thawed
All-purpose flour, for dusting
2 large eggs, lightly beaten

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ees. Combine cheese and cayenne in a bowl.
  • Lay each puff-pastry sheet flat on a lightly floured work surface. Roll out two 11-by-16-inch rectangles. Dividing evenly, brush with some of beaten eggs and sprinkle with cheese mixture. Using a pastry cutter or sharp paring knife, trim long ends to make even, then cut each rectangle crosswise into fifteen 1/2-inch-wide strips.
  • Working with one at a time, twist each strip into a spiral and transfer to parchment-lined baking sheets, 1 inch apart. Using your thumb, press ends of strips onto parchment to prevent unraveling during baking. Chill until firm, at least 30 minutes.
  • Bake until pastry is golden, rotating sheets halfway through, 10 to 15 minutes. Let cool completely on sheets on wire racks before serving or storing.

CHEESE STRAWS WITH HOMEMADE PUFF PASTRY



Cheese Straws with Homemade Puff Pastry image

When twisting the straws into shape, don't worry if you lose up to three tablespoons of cheese; plenty will remain inside and you can sprinkle any lost over the outside.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Appetizers     Finger Food Recipes

Yield Makes about 2 dozen

Number Of Ingredients 6

All-purpose flour, for work surface
1 1/2 pounds Puff Pastry Dough
1 large egg, lightly beaten
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
4 ounces coarsely grated Parmesan cheese (about 1 1/2 cups)

Steps:

  • On a lightly floured surface, using a rolling pin, gently roll pastry dough into a 14-inch square 1/8 inch thick. Be careful not to press too hard on the edges. Using a pastry brush, dust off excess flour; brush beaten egg over lower half of dough until it is well moistened.
  • In a small bowl, mix together salt and cayenne. Sprinkle half the salt mixture over egg-washed portion of dough. Sprinkle half the grated cheese over the same half; fold the uncovered dough over the cheese-covered section. Gently press all over the dough with your fingers to seal the dough halves together.
  • Brush top of dough again with beaten egg to moisten; sprinkle remaining salt mixture and cheese evenly over the top.
  • Using a pastry wheel or sharp knife, trim edges, and cut dough into 1/2-inch vertical strips. Twist strips into spiraled straws, and lay 1 inch apart on three ungreased baking sheets. To prevent straws from straightening out again, gently press both ends to adhere them to the baking sheet. Cover with plastic wrap; place in refrigerator 1 hour.
  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ees. Place in oven, and bake 15 minutes. Reduce oven heat to 350 degrees; continue baking until straws are golden brown and cooked all the way through, about 5 minutes. Remove from oven; using a thin spatula, immediately transfer straws to a wire rack to cool completely before serving.
